Cardboard is an innovative, collaborative video editing platform powered by AI that operates directly in the browser, enabling users to seamlessly create, edit, and assemble videos without the hassle of downloading software or navigating intricate workflows. Built as an “agentic” editor, it allows users to issue high-level commands such as generating initial cuts, producing short-form videos, or converting raw footage into advertising content, with the AI system adeptly interpreting and carrying out those directives. Users can efficiently handle a variety of raw materials, including interviews, screen captures, and supplementary footage, transforming them into refined videos in just moments. Additionally, Cardboard features a semantic search capability that enables users to locate clips based on their content rather than their filenames, and it includes a timeline interface for those who wish to fine-tune AI-generated edits manually. By merging AI-driven media analysis with cutting-edge browser technologies, Cardboard significantly diminishes the requirement for users to possess advanced technical skills. This user-friendly approach ensures that anyone, regardless of their editing experience, can produce professional-quality videos effortlessly.

The NVIDIA Synthetic Video Detector is an advanced microservice powered by AI, specifically created to assess whether a video is genuine or generated by artificial intelligence. Its primary focus is on content generated through diffusion models, making it particularly suitable for applications in media authentication, digital forensics, content verification, broadcast processes, and ensuring the integrity of media. The tool evaluates MP4 video inputs and provides a prediction for each individual frame on a continuum from 0 to 1; where values leaning towards 0 suggest authenticity and those nearing 1 indicate synthetic origins. Furthermore, it is engineered to maintain its effectiveness even under typical video compression scenarios, which helps in sustaining reliable detection capabilities after the footage has undergone processing or distribution via standard media channels. Utilizing a Vision Transformer architecture that incorporates an ensemble of DINOv2 and DINOv3 backbones, it adeptly merges visual representations to differentiate between real and artificially created video content. Input frames are resized to 504 x 504 pixels and subjected to normalization prior to the inference process, ensuring optimal performance in the analysis. This sophisticated approach enables a robust assessment of video authenticity, making it a vital tool in the evolving landscape of digital media verification.
